Calculation of the shock response spectrum of the prestressed steel cable
The abrupt fracture of prestressed steel strand will form a great unloading impact force, which will influence the displacement and internal force of the remaining structure. Shock response spectrum method can reduce the computation and ensure the accuracy.

Polymorph‐Specific Electronic Transduction in WO3 during Molecular Sensing
Metal‐oxide polymorphs with similar surface chemistry can nevertheless exhibit distinct sensing properties. In γ‐ and ε‐WO3, analyte adsorption appears comparable; yet, only ε‐WO3 induces a pronounced lattice electronic perturbation that accommodates charge in sub‐conduction band minimum states.
